量子计算视角下的Linux小程序开发工具链构建指南
|
在量子计算与经典计算的交汇点上,Linux平台为开发者提供了丰富的工具和环境,支持构建高效的小程序开发工具链。量子计算的复杂性要求开发者在传统编程基础上,掌握新的算法逻辑和硬件交互方式。 Linux系统本身具备良好的开源生态,许多量子计算框架如Qiskit、Cirq等都优先支持Linux环境。开发者可以通过包管理器安装必要的依赖库,并利用虚拟化技术搭建隔离的开发环境。 构建工具链时,推荐使用Python作为主要编程语言,因其在量子算法实现中具有广泛的社区支持。同时,集成开发环境(IDE)如VS Code或Jupyter Notebook能够提升开发效率,提供代码调试和可视化功能。 在量子模拟方面,可以借助QEMU或专用的量子仿真器进行测试,确保代码在真实量子硬件部署前的正确性。版本控制工具如Git有助于团队协作和代码管理,保障开发过程的可追溯性。 对于小程序而言,应注重轻量化和模块化设计,减少对系统资源的依赖。通过封装量子计算核心逻辑,开发者可以创建可复用的组件,提高整体开发效率。
图像AI模拟效果,仅供参考 持续关注量子计算领域的最新进展,及时更新工具链中的依赖库和驱动程序,确保开发环境的兼容性和稳定性。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

